Saturday, August 1, 2009

The Way Forward in Sri Lanka

The way forward in Sri Lanka involves demilitarisation, restoration of the rule of law, and democratisation. These are interlinked so closely that it is impossible to separate them, and on their fulfilment depends not only the political future of Sri Lanka, but also its economic survival. 

Ending Israel's Genocide in Palestine

On 5 December 2024, Amnesty International released a report which concluded that the Israeli state is committing genocide in Gaza in the str...